1850 Amethyst Brooch
|
|
View More
Amethyst pendant/brooch, ca. 1850, with three oval amethysts of approx. 15 cts. EACH, claw- and collet-set in a open-backed framework of unmarked 15k gold. These natural amethysts are a beautiful shade of rich violet, and are matched for color. The frame t boasts elegant scrollwork in both matte and shiny textures, applied swirls and beadwork, and bright-cut engraving! 2 3/4" long x 2" wide, and weighs 16.6 grams! It retains its original "T" bar clasp, although the "C" part of the clasp has been replaced with an early 15k locking clasp ca. 1900. There is also a small loop at the top of the brooch which would also allow it to be worn as a pendant if a jump ring were to be added.

Etruscan Pietra Dura Pin 1860 18K
|
|
View More
Victorian 18K gold Etruscan revival and pietra dura pin. This piece was made in Italy between 1850 to 1875. The gold work has wonderful applied decorations, twisted wires and bead work, true to the ancient Etruscan style. Some of the twisted wires have come off over the years, but overall the condition is very good. The hinge is original but the pin back and clasp have certainly been replaced. There is a small amount of lead solder visible on the interior backside of the pin. The gold frame has some minor bends but no dents, no splits, no holes, no cracks and no other problems.
The stone work is quite unique. This is not typical pietra dura stone work and I am not sure it could even be called pietra dura. Traditional pietra dura work has a smooth surface. A group of stones are inlaid into a larger stone to create a design. In this particular piece the stones are all carved in a high three dimensional relief and are applied on top of the stone. The large black stone has been re- set and re-glued into this piece.
The dimensions of the gold frame are 2 1/4 inches or 57.5 mm by 1 7/8 inches or 48 mm. The stone measures 1 3/4 inches or 44 mm by 1 1/2 inches or 38 mm.
